to see their place in my pedigree chart.) No possible marriage has
been found in the Sussex marriage indexes or the IGI. Although Richard
was born in Cuckfield, Sussex and raised his family there, his marriage to
Elizabeth (or anyone else) was not recorded in the Cuckfield marriage
register.
Richard
French was baptised on 30
January 1619/20 in Cuckfield. He was the illegitmate son of widow
French, by "one Bryant as supposed". Might his mother have been
Joan Mudrell who married Francis French in Fletching, Sussex on
11 August 1600? Francis, a husbandman, was buried on 12 June 1611 in
Cuckfield. Or might she have previously been the wife of
William Frenche who in 1613 had a daughter Ann baptised in
Cuckfield. William was then described as a "filler at the furnis".
William's burial has not been found in the Cuckfield burial register, nor
have I found a likely marriage for William before 1613.
On 11 June 1620, Joane Frenche of Cuckfield and daughter of
widow Joane, was apprenticed to Richard Parkes, yeoman of
Cuckfield, until the age of 21. Four days later on 15 June
Richard Parkes took on another apprentice, namely Henry
Mitten, in husbandry until the age of 24. Then on 20 August
1626, Francis French of Cuckfield was apprenticed to
Richard Hammond, thatcher until he was 24 years old.
On 21 January 1634, 13 year old Richard French was
apprenticed to John Garton, yeoman, until he was 24 years
old.
Elizabeth's
date and place of birth/baptism are unknown, to me.
Richard French and
Elizabeth had 10 known children:
-
Anne French was baptised on 27 March 1642 in Cuckfield and buried
there on 5 August 1642.
-
John French was baptised on 21 December 1645 in Cuckfield.
-
Richard French was baptised on 22 August 1648 in Cuckfield.
-
William French was baptised on 20 April 1651 in Cuckfield.
-
Thomas French was baptised on 1 October 1653 in Cuckfield.
-
An infant of Richard and Elizabeth was born on 5 July 1657 in Cuckfield
and buried there on 9 July 1657.
-
Joane French was born on 4 July 1658 and her birth was register the
Cuckfield parish registers. She was buried there on 6 December 1659.
-
Henry French was baptised on 14 October 1660 in Cuckfield.
Henry
married twice. Firstly Jone King by banns on 6 May 1694 in
Cuckfield. He then married Jane
Vaughan on 6 April 1697 in Slaugham, Sussex. At the time they
were both of Cuckfield.
Jone was buried in Cuckfield on 20 February 1697/8 and it
was recorded in the burial register that she was Joan wife of
Henry French of Holmstead.
-
Charles French was baptised on 17 May 1663 in Cuckfield. He
was buried there on 14 September 1729.
Charles married Susan
Vidlers by banns on 2 June 1692 in Cuckfield. They were both
then single.
Charles and Susan had the following child:
-
John French was baptised on 22 July 1694 in Cuckfield and buried
there on 19 August 1694.
-
Charles French may have been part of this family. He
married Elizabeth Willing on 21 September 1748 in the Fleet
Prison, London. Charles was then a bachelor and chimney sweep and
Elizabeth a spinster. They were both of Cuckfield.
-
Frederick
French, my 7x Great Grandfather, was baptised on 28 May 1667 in
Cuckfield. He married Mary in about 1691. (They have
their own page.)
Francis French and
Joan Mudrell had 4 known children:
-
Elinor French
was baptised on 28 June 1601 in Cuckfield.
-
Jone French
was baptised on 7 April 1604 in Cuckfield. Her father was then of
Brode Street.
-
John French
was baptised on 5 April 1607 in Cuckfield.
-
Frances French
(son) was baptised on 12 August 1610.
